Gorakhpur Bride Dies Under Suspicious Circumstances Two Days After Wedding
In a tragic incident that has shocked the community, celebrations turned into mourning in the PP Ganj area of Gorakhpur after a 21-year-old woman died under suspicious circumstances just two days after her wedding. The deceased, identified as Seema, had married Manoj, a resident of Badhni village under the P P Ganj police station limits, on February 20.
Family Files Murder Complaint Amid Dowry Harassment Allegations
The deceased's mother filed a formal complaint of murder on Tuesday, alleging foul play in her daughter's untimely death. According to police reports, Seema, the daughter of Kamal Devi from Ratanpur village in the Pipraich area, arrived at her in-laws' home on February 21. The very next evening, her family received a distressing call informing them that she was unwell.
She was immediately rushed to BRD Medical College for emergency treatment, but tragically, she succumbed and died during the course of medical care. Seema's parents have made serious allegations, claiming that when they reached the hospital, her in-laws had already fled the scene, leaving her body behind.
Allegations of Dowry Harassment Surface
In her complaint, Seema's mother has accused her husband and his family of harassing her for dowry, suggesting that this may have led to the fatal incident. The family's allegations have added a layer of complexity to the case, raising concerns about domestic violence and dowry-related crimes in the region.
Police Investigation Underway
Campierganj Circle Officer Anurag Singh has confirmed that the cause of death will be determined only after the postmortem report is received. The police are actively investigating the matter, treating it as a suspicious death case. Authorities have assured that all aspects, including the dowry harassment allegations, will be thoroughly examined to ascertain the truth behind this heartbreaking event.
